I've had three mycobags for ~5 months that have been sitting underneath my desk. Could they have dried out/gone stale/etc? I wouldn't want to waste spores on bad mycobags.

If the verm still sticks to the sides of the bags, and the insides seem moist, they aren't too dry.
Just make sure to inoculate them neer the wall of the bag so the spores get on the plastic too.
If they stayed wrapped up, they would have a very hard time losing moisture.

I don't know about this. I've had bags that I made dry out after 2 or 3 months sitting in my closet. They're usually o.k. for a while, though -- I've re-inoc'ed after 2 months with no growth and got great results.
The filter-patch keeps conataminants out, but doesn't prevent water vapour from escaping. If it looks dry, chances are it's dry.
